Subject: [PATCH 09/15] wistron_btns: Add Acer TravelMate 240 key mappings.

diff --git a/drivers/input/misc/wistron_btns.c b/drivers/input/misc/wistron_btns.c
index bac3085..b77e269 100644
--- a/drivers/input/misc/wistron_btns.c
+++ b/drivers/input/misc/wistron_btns.c
@@ -296,6 +296,16 @@ static struct key_entry keymap_acer_aspi
{ KE_END, 0 }
};
+static struct key_entry keymap_acer_travelmate_240[] = {
+ { KE_KEY, 0x31, KEY_MAIL },
+ { KE_KEY, 0x36, KEY_WWW },
+ { KE_KEY, 0x11, KEY_PROG1 },
+ { KE_KEY, 0x12, KEY_PROG2 },
+ { KE_BLUETOOTH, 0x44, 0 },
+ { KE_WIFI, 0x30, 0 },
+ { KE_END, 0 }
+};
+
/*
* If your machine is not here (which is currently rather likely), please send
* a list of buttons and their key codes (reported when loading this module
@@ -320,6 +330,15 @@ static struct dmi_system_id dmi_ids[] =
},
.driver_data = keymap_acer_aspire_1500
},
+ {
+ .callback = dmi_matched,
+ .ident = "Acer TravelMate 240",
+ .matches = {
+ DMI_MATCH(DMI_SYS_VENDOR, "Acer"),
+ DMI_MATCH(DMI_PRODUCT_NAME, "TravelMate 240"),
+ },
+ .driver_data = keymap_acer_travelmate_240
+ },
{ NULL, }
};
